From: Bob Higgins 

 

After reading the "Electron Transitions on Deep Dirac Levels II" by Dr.s Maly 
and Va'vra, I was intrigued to find the other papers.  I did not find a copy of 
"... I", or any of the III, IV, and V versions that Dr. Va'vra indicated were 
submitted [note: if any of you have a copy of "Electron Transitions on Deep 
Dirac Levels I", could you please share a copy with me?]. When I researched the 
ANS publication Fusion Technology, I found in their listing the "... I" and 
"... II" papers, but none of the others. So, I did some additional research to 
find Dr. Va'vra. I found his email and asked him about the latter 3 papers.  
Here was his interesting response:

 

"The papers III,IV and V do exist, but they were not published. I think the 
editor of the Fusion Technology had enough at that time.

 

 However, there is a problem with all these types of calculations. They use a 
1920-1930 quantum mechanics. The correct treatment must use QED. There were 
attempts to do that, and I mention that in my more recent ArXiv paper: 
1304.0833v3.

 

 Mills used fractional quantum numbers. That is a "no no" for the classical 
quantum mechanics. So, I consider his method wrong.

 

 Regards, Jerry"

 

Dr. Va'vra has a 2013 ArXiv paper (http://arxiv.org/pdf/1304.0833v3.pdf) - I 
think it is a fascinating fit to this thread.  If someone else already cited 
this, I apologize for the duplication.
